Did the Shan Prince or Tai Prince Chaolung Chukapha come to Assam from the Shan Kingdom of Myanmar or from Yunnan Province of China? Chukapha's mother's original home was Mao Lung or Mongmao in Yunnan Province, China, now known as Ruili. However, Chukapha's father's original home is mong ri mong ram now known as Mong Mit in the Shan State of Myanmar. History tells us that Chukapha was born in the house of his mother, his uncle, and grew up in Mao Lung or Mongmao. Chukapha's uncle had no sons. After Chukapha became prince of Mong Mao for 19 years, his uncle had two sons. His uncle's two sons were Chu-Khan- Fa/Pha and Sem-Lung-Fa/Pha. Chu ka Fa/pha's mother ( Nang Blak Kham Sen) had three son's - Chu-Jut-Fa/pha , Chu- Kam-Fa/pha and Chu-Ka- Fa/Pha. Chukapha's father chao chang nyeu ( alias Phu-Chang-Khang) got mong mao to expand the kingdom. The kingdom was ruled by Chukapha's uncle (Pa-Meo-Pung) .There, Chukapha's father wanted to fight and expand his kingdom, but he ( Pa-Meo-Pung) was not prepared for war and made a treaty with his sister Nang Black Kham Chen, proposing marriage to Chao Chang Nyeu ( alias Phu-Chang-Khang) . Chu-ka-pha/Fa had to leave the kingdom of Maomao. After death Pa-Meo-Pung two sons, Sue Khan Pha/Fa and Sam Lung Pha/Fa seized Chukapha's father's kingdom and killed his elder brother Chu Jut Pha/Fa in battle.There, in Mongmit, Chukapha was appointed as a subordinate king. At that time, uncle's son Chukhanpha sought Chukapha's help in expanding a country. However, his uncle's son, King Chu-khan-pha/Fa of Maomao, became angry and went to war, and Chu-ka-pha/Fa left the war with his uncle's son and dreamed of building an independent country. Chukapha crossed the Pangsau Pass with about 9,000 troops and entered Mong Dong Song kham, now Tipam ( Assam) with the intention of establishing his own independent country. After a difficult journey, Chu-ka-pha/Fa had to stay in places for a while and engage in warfare.

As a Bodo speaking Bodo as my mother tongue from Kokrajhar, Bodoland Territorial Region, Assam. As being a Khilonjiya Oxomiya (Indigenous Assamese) and also Bodos being regarded as the earliest settlers of assam as it is taught in the universities of assam in history, anthropology and sociology. I believe that I have the privilege to type this comment. This is not a hatred comment for my ethnic-assamese brothers and sisters of assam who speak assamese as their first language. Ahoms spoke Tai-ahom and Tai-ahom was their court language not assamese. Assamese originated from old Prakrit but eventually became sanskritised language and lingua franca of Assam only after brahminisation by brahmins from Orissa or mainland India during the late periods of the Ahom dynasty or even as late as early 19th century. Learned assamese people generally knows about this. Anyway, just for the facts. How Bodos are the first settlers of Assam ?! Generally, Bodos as a people from mongoloid race are supposedly considered to have settled in assam atleast 7000 years ago from being nomadic people north of the himalayas from mongolia, china and tibet into agrarian based tribe into plains and valleys of Assam. Bodos or Boro-Kacharis, a plain tribe and the Dimasas or Dimasa-Kacharis, a hill tribe of assam speaking linguistically similar Sino-tibetan languages Bodo and Dimasa, respectively doesn't like glorifying much about the Ahoms because they are regarded as invaders in both the history of the Bodos and the Dimasas having been people related to the kachari kingdom. Also Kacharis are also mentioned as Kiratas in ancient Hindu texts. Ahoms are generally taken as invaders who came from Yunan, China and later ruled assam by both the Bodos and the Dimasas. The Kacharis already had an established dynasty in Assam with capital Dimapur, presently in Nagaland before the Ahoms came in Assam. Dimapur is derived from Bodo and Dimasa meaning City above the large water/river and even believe to derived mythologicaly to be derived from the Asura Hidimba and his sister Asuri Hidimbi whom Bhima married in the Mahabharata. Ahoms and Kacharis had many clashes. The Kacharis defeated the Ahoms couple of times initially. The ahoms had to offer princesses to the Kachari Kings after the defeat. . However, Ahoms later defeated the Kacharis and sacked Dimapur. The Kachari ruins in dimapur are very much evident even today. After the destruction of Dimapur, the Dimasas had to flee to the hills in middle of Assam. However, they established Dimasa kingdom and dynasty again with capital Maibang and Khaspur in the southern plains of Assam in Barak valley near Silchar. The Bodos on the other hand who claim to be from the earliest ruling clan 'Bodosa' of the kacharis believe to have fled to the northern plains of the Brahmaputra(Burllungbuthur in Bodo) in western assam near the foothills of Bhutan and Arunachal Pradesh and again became a distinctively agrarian based plain tribe differently from the Dimasas. Just like the ahom has Buranjis for their records. The Bodos had deodhai script for the records but it is undeciphered now and sometimes the Ahoms are blamed for the cause. Kalaguru Bishnu Prasad Rabha collected many samples of Deodhai script from Kachari ruin monoliths in dimapur. Everyone knows about Lachit Borphukon in Assam. His statue is built in the Brahmaputra in Guwahati. Only few know about Jwhwlao Dwimalu (Bodo) and Veer Demalik Kemprai (Dimasa), the same chief warrior or army general whose statues are built in Kokrajhar, Bodoland Territorial Region and Haflong, Dima Hasao, respectively. He defeated many neighbouring burmese kingdom armies and brought white elephants as souvenirs. His legacy however sadly ends with tragedy of curses to the tribes or the whole kachari community. His life story is the same in Bodo history and Dimasa history thus believed to be the same person but his historical timeline is little bit controversial among Bodos and Dimasas. Jwhwlao Dwimalu was from 8th century as mentioned in the statue in kokrajhar according to the bodos and Veer Demalik Kemprai from early 13th century (1200s) according to the Dimasas. Now here's the scenario, even if latter Veer Demalik Kemprai's lifetime timeline is taken into consideration. It's same time Sukaphaa, the first king of the ahoms came to Assam and established Ahom kingdom in Assam.
